Broken Pipe Repair in Denver, CO
Broken pipe repair services address issues involving damaged or burst pipes within residential properties. This type of service covers a range of projects, including fixing leaks caused by freezing temperatures, replacing corroded or aging pipes, and repairing pipes that have been punctured or cracked due to accidents or ground shifting. Property owners typically want to understand the causes of pipe damage, the signs indicating a broken pipe (such as water pooling, low water pressure, or unexplained increases in water bills), and the steps involved in restoring proper plumbing function.
Before requesting broken pipe repair, homeowners should consider the location and extent of the damage, the type of pipes affected, and whether the issue is isolated or part of a larger plumbing system concern. It’s also helpful to know if the repair process will require temporary water shutoff or if additional repairs, such as pipe replacement, might be necessary. Clear communication about the scope of the problem can help ensure the most effective and efficient service response.

Broken Pipe Repair Questions
What causes a pipe to break? Breaks can result from freezing temperatures, corrosion, or ground shifting, leading to pressure buildup and pipe failure.
How can I tell if a pipe is broken? Signs include water leaks, low water pressure, or unexplained water bills, indicating a possible pipe issue.
What types of pipes are commonly repaired? Repairs often involve copper, PVC, or galvanized pipes depending on the property’s plumbing system.
Is it possible to prevent pipe breaks? Proper insulation, regular inspections, and addressing minor leaks early can help reduce the risk of pipe failures.
